#2c032e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2c032e is composed of 17.3% red, 1.2%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.3%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 297.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 9.6%. #2c032e color hex could be obtained by blending #58065c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#2c032e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090109 is the darkest color, while #fef6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c032e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#191819 is the less saturated color, while #2e0130 is the most saturated one.
